Sir Harry Secombe was one of Britain's best loved entertainers.

After his death in April 2001, at the age of 79, the former Prime Minister John Major paid tribute to him as: `one of the loveliest of men and a comic genius who gave pleasure to millions.' In this second volume of autobiography, the sequel to his highly praised Arias and Raspberries, he covers his life from 1951.

He tells wonderful behind-the-scenes stories of the legendary Goon Shows with Spike Milligan, Peter Sellers and Michael Bentine, with several hilarious excerpts from the original recordings. He recalls marvellous anecdotes about his role as Mr Bumble in the film Oliver! and his title role in the stage musical Pickwick; his numerous radio and television shows, including the long-running series Highway, and his family life in Cheam.
